Retirement investing simply means investing with the goal of being self-sufficient during your retirement days.
It means investing with the sole purpose of having your investment generate income that will pay the bills when you retire.
Some people call this investing for income.The sad part is that a lot of people are not concerned about retirement.
They have a good job, live in a good house, drive a great car, and believe life will continue like this forever.
Consequently, they do not make investing for retirement a priority.
